A lost garden comes back again
Mount Vesuvius in Italy erupted (爆发) in 79 CE. It destroyed a garden. Experts found signs of flowers and fruit trees there. These plants were grown to make natural perfumes (香水). Now flowers and fruit trees have been planted again in the garden. They remind visitors of the garden's history.

The Postal Service introduces zip codes (邮编)
In 1963, the US Postal Service began to use zip codes to deliver the mail more efficiently. The new way was not popular at first because people were not sure that they could remember the numbers. Today, there are nearly 42,000 zip codes in the US.

A famous shipwreck (沉船) is found
In 2022, researchers proved that a shipwreck off the coast of Rhode Island is the Endeavor, a famous lost ship. British explorer James Cook was the ship's leader from 1768 to 1771, and he became the first European to reach the eastern coast of Australia and other places. England later took over the ship and sold it. The ship sank in 1778.

The first woman pilot who broke the sound barrier (音障)
On May 18, 1953, Jacqueline Cochran became the first woman to break the sound barrier. Cochran helped train women pilots during World War II. When she died in 1980, she held the most flying records of any person, man or woman.
